The Kamehameha Schools Maui campus is seeking a Journeyman Plumber to join our Campus Operations team. The role focuses on maintenance, repair, and modifications of campus plumbing and irrigation systems, with an emphasis on water distribution, hydrants, and well facilities.
Applicants should have a minimum of five years as a Journeyman Plumber, hold a State Certified Journeyman Plumber License, and possess a valid driver's license.

The Kamehameha Schools Maui campus is seeking a skilled Journeyman Plumber to join our Campus Operations team. A strong background in the maintenance and repair of irrigation systems is highly preferred.
This full‑time regular position offers a comprehensive benefits package.
Performs maintenance, repair, and modifications of campus plumbing systems, equipment, and machinery including water distribution systems, water mains, fire hydrants, irrigation systems, and well‑pumping and treatment stations as applicable. Works closely with internal teams to coordinate workflow and ensure efficient, high‑quality project completion.
Frequently walks, stands, bends, crouches, reaches overhead, and performs fine motor tasks. Often requires lifting, carrying, pushing or pulling objects weighing up to 20 pounds; occasional heavy lifting up to 50 pounds. Requires twisting, bending, stooping, squatting, kneeling, crawling, and at times working in cramped or awkward positions.
May involve traveling to various locations, including neighboring islands. Work is conducted in an office/school environment and may require work to be conducted in non‑standard workplaces. Work is typically performed Monday through Friday during regular business hours; availability to work evenings, weekends, and respond to emergencies on a 24/7 basis is required.
Hourly Compensation: $34.77 – $47.21. The range is based on experience, skills, and other organizational needs.
